Limits of poker bets and raises

If you are playing poker with a fixed limit, you have to know the limits of your bets and raises. There are typically two bet sizes: small and big. For hold’em and omaha games, the big bet is twice as large as the small bet. The name of the big bet is small slash big, and it’s usually indicated by a number at the end of the bet.
